I've always been curious about where and when patches came into gi culture. In corporate judo competitions in japan, judokah usually have patches. I know most BJJ schools also require, or allow, their students to wear patches. However, the fad doesn't appear to have caught on with regular judo schools, Aikido, or TJJ/JJJ. I've seen Sambo fighters with patches, Fedor has several large sponsor logo's on his sambo uniform.
